'The Voice' season 9 results to be announced Wednesday

For the first time, the fate of the artists who will move on and earn a spot at the Top 12 of "The Voice" will lie in the hands of the viewers this season.

The artists from Team Adam and Team Gwen kicked off the first live playoff performances thihs week for the ninth season of NBC's hit reality competition as they vie to earn a slot at the Top 12, which will be announced on Wednesday.

Each member of the teams took the stage to let the viewers know that they are deserving to stay in the singing reality competition for a chance of being crowned as the winner of "The Voice" season 9.

But aside from letting the viewers pick the artists that stood out during Tuesday's live performance night, "The Voice" also introduced a new twist this season where the coaches can bring back some of their previously eliminated artists to perform in the Live Playoffs with the remaining 20 contestants to get another shot in the singing competition.

Team Adam's artists were all pumped up as they sang their hearts out during their performances. Former country singer Blaine Mitchell sang INXS's "Never Tear Us Apart," while rish rocker Keith Semple performed Mr. Big's "To Be With You." Amy Vachal performed "The Way You Look Tonight" by Frank Sinatra and Shelby Brown sang "You're No Good" by Wilson Phillips, while Jordan Smith sang "Halo" by Beyoncé.

Team Adam's comeback artist Chance Peña performed "Barton Hollow" by The Civil Wars to earn the rights to get back to the competition.

For Team Gwen, Regina Love perfomed Adele's latest hit single "Hello," while Korin Bukowski had a moving performance with Sarah McLachlan's iconic song "Adia." Jeffery Austin sang "Say You Love Me" by Jessie Ware and Braiden Sunshine performed "Everything I Own" by Red and Viktor Király sang "All Around The World" by Lisa Stansfield.

Meanwhile, Team Gwen's comeback artist Ellie Lawrence performed her own rendition of Elle King's "Ex's & Oh's."

Voting for Team Adam and Team Gwen's artists began immediately after the show and will last until 12 p.m. ET Wednesday night before Carson Daly announces who made the Top 12.
